谓词生成

当前话题为您枚举了最新的 谓词生成。在这里,您可以轻松访问广泛的教程、示例代码和实用工具,帮助您有效地学习和应用这些核心编程技术。查看页面下方的资源列表,快速下载您需要的资料。我们的资源覆盖从基础到高级的各种主题,无论您是初学者还是有经验的开发者,都能找到有价值的信息。

谓词生成举例-分布式数据库设计的优化
谓词生成举例中包含关系E(e#,name,loc,sal,…),查询谓词如Ai  Value: A5,Loc = Sa,Loc = Sb。下一步是生成“小项”谓词,并消除不必要的谓词。给定简单谓词集Pr= { p1, p2,.. pn },则“小项”谓词(minterm predicate)的形式为:p1  p2  …  pn,其中pk是pk或¬pk。
数据库中的存在谓词与NOT EXISTS谓词详解
存在量词带有EXISTS谓词的子查询仅返回逻辑真值“true”或逻辑假值“false”。若内层查询结果非空,则外层的WHERE子句返回真值;若内层查询结果为空,则外层的WHERE子句返回假值。由EXISTS引出的子查询通常使用*作为目标列表达式,因为其只返回真值或假值,列名无实际意义。NOT EXISTS谓词的作用与EXISTS相反,若内层查询结果非空,则外层的WHERE子句返回假值;若内层查询结果为空,则外层的WHERE子句返回真值。
连接谓词-SQL查询指南
连接谓词在WHERE子句中通过比较运算符提供连接条件。 连接谓词的格式:<表1.列名> <运算符> <表2.列名> 运算符:=(等值连接)、!=、>、<、>=、<= 等值连接:运算符为“=”;若去除相同字段名,称为自然连接。 复合条件连接:多个连接条件。 自连接:表与自身连接。
SQL子查询语法讲解(IN谓词续)
带 IN 谓词的子查询用法,蛮适合刚接触 SQL 或者想打基础的同学。用WHERE Sdept = 'IS'这种筛选方式挺常见,查 IS 系学生这种场景一看就懂。例子不复杂,结果也直观,写法简洁明了,适合练手或者当个模板参考。配合下面这些相关子查询的资料一块看,理解会更扎实些,像EXISTS、ANY那些谓词,用得顺手以后,复杂查询也能搞定。
子查询谓词在 SQL 中的应用
子查询可通过谓词与主查询连接,常用的谓词包括: IN 比较运算符 ANY 或 ALL EXISTS
EXISTS谓词续:数据库教程
求没选修1号课程的学生姓名: select sname from student where not exists ( select * from sc where student.sno = sno and cno = '1' ) 如果不用EXISTS谓词,也能完成查询: select sname from student where sno not in ( select sno from sc where cno = '1' )
深入理解ANY/ALL谓词子查询
使用ANY/ALL谓词增强SQL子查询 ANY和ALL谓词为SQL子查询赋予了强大的比较能力,允许您将主查询的值与子查询返回的多个值进行比较。 >, =, <, >=, <= 与 ANY(ALL) 这些运算符与ANY或ALL谓词结合使用,可以判断主查询的值是否满足以下条件: ANY: 大于/大于等于/小于/小于等于/等于子查询结果中的任何值。 ALL: 大于/大于等于/小于/小于等于/等于子查询结果中的所有值。 通过灵活运用ANY/ALL谓词,您可以构建更复杂、更精确的查询逻辑,轻松应对多值比较场景。
ANY(SOME)、ALL谓词使用详解-SQL教程
ANY 和 ALL 这俩 SQL 里的谓词,真的是在子查询里蛮常见的,尤其做条件判断的时候好用。any(有时候写作 some)是“只要有一个满足就行”,而 all 则是“必须全都满足才行”。听起来像小学生数学题?但实际用起来还挺精妙的。 比如你查一堆订单金额大于某用户所有订单金额,那就用 ALL。换成 ANY 呢,就是大于这个用户任意一个订单的金额。SELECT 语句一加,就能玩出不少组合技。 而且它俩的搭配技巧也挺灵活的,有时候还能用 min 或 max 来等价替代。像 t = ANY(subquery) 其实就跟 t IN (subquery) 差不多,只不过用法更灵活。要想彻底搞懂,推荐
GBase 8s SQL 函数与谓词详解
sqlcli> SELECT MOD(29,9);-> 2
引出SQL语句中子查询的谓词教程
介绍SQL语句中引出子查询的不同谓词:带有IN谓词的子查询、带有比较运算符的子查询、带有ANY或ALL谓词的子查询以及带有EXISTS谓词的子查询。